Description

When someone we love deeply dies, life goes on. So, when my mother died, I quickly realised that the sun would continue on its usual course and that the earth would keep turning on its axis. And so it was. Today marks a full year (yes, a whole year has passed!) since the day my mother was admitted to the Palliative Care Unit at the IPO in Porto, the place where she passed away with dignity, humanity and serenity, surrounded by the love of her family and the care of incomparable professionals. The building housing the palliative and long-term care service at the IPO in Porto was built and is maintained largely with money from donations. At the time of my mother’s passing, we made a donation to the staff, but I always felt a desire to do more for the service. For this reason, I decided that I would like to organise this annual fundraising campaign so that, on my birthday, I can gather all the love you wish to show me and convert it into funds that will help people at the end of their lives, so that they too may have the same conditions my mother had.

Out of all the gratitude I feel for the Palliative and Continuing Care Service at the IPO in Porto, I would like to make a request: this year, on my birthday, please do not buy me a present. Instead, help me to give meaning and purpose to the first year of my life without a mother, because, as you know, my last day as a 31-year-old was also the last day of my mother’s life. Because that will always be part of my story, but above all because it doesn’t have to be just sad and lifeless; let’s give love, care and human dignity.


Thank you so much ❤️
